Enjoy this 2.2-mile loop trail near Busdorf, Schleswig-Holstein. Generally considered an easy route, it takes an average of 49 min to complete. This is a popular trail for birding and walking, but you can still enjoy some solitude during quieter times of day. The trail is open year-round and is beautiful to visit anytime. Dogs are welcome, but must be on a leash.
